Why the Right Boxing Gloves Matter

Boxing gloves do more than just cushion your fists—they play a crucial role in protecting your hands, wrists, and even your opponent. The right gloves can prevent injuries, improve performance, and provide a better overall training experience.

Injury Prevention

Your hands are one of the most vulnerable parts of your body in boxing. The wrong gloves can lead to knuckle bruises, wrist strains, and long-term joint damage. High-quality gloves with proper padding and wrist support minimize these risks.

Performance Enhancement

Well-designed gloves help improve your punching technique, ensuring that your fists land with precision and maximum force without unnecessary strain.

Comfort & Fit

A good pair of gloves should feel like an extension of your hand. Gloves that are too tight or too loose can cause discomfort, leading to poor form and hand fatigue.

Durability & Longevity

Investing in quality gloves means saving money in the long run. Cheap gloves wear out quickly, losing padding and structure, which increases the risk of injury.

Key Features to Consider in Boxing Gloves

Leather vs. Synthetic

  • Genuine leather gloves (like Cleto Reyes or Winning) last longer and mold to your hands over time.
  • Synthetic leather gloves (such as Sanabul or Everlast) offer affordability while maintaining durability.

Padding & Protection

  • Multi-layered foam padding is essential for shock absorption.
  • Gel-infused gloves provide extra cushioning for heavy hitters.

Wrist Support: Velcro vs. Lace-Up

  • Velcro closure: Best for easy on-and-off use, common in training gloves.
  • Lace-up gloves: Preferred for competition and professional use, offering a tighter wrist lock.

Weight Selection

The weight of the gloves determines their function:

  • 10-12 oz: Best for competition and speed training.
  • 14-16 oz: Ideal for sparring and heavy bag work.
  • 16+ oz: Recommended for extra wrist and knuckle protection.

Breathability & Comfort

  • Ventilation holes or mesh panels help keep hands dry and prevent odor buildup.

Proper Glove Care & Maintenance

How to Clean Your Gloves

Keeping your gloves clean is crucial for preventing bacteria buildup and unpleasant odors. After every session, wipe them down with a dry cloth or disinfectant wipes to remove sweat and moisture. For deeper cleaning, use a disinfectant spray or specialized glove deodorizer to eliminate bacteria and keep them smelling fresh.

Storage Tips

Proper storage helps maintain the integrity of your gloves. Never leave them in a closed gym bag, as trapped moisture can lead to bacteria growth and bad odors. Instead, allow them to air dry in a cool, dry place. Storing them in an open, ventilated area ensures they remain fresh and ready for your next training session.

Breaking in Your Gloves

New gloves often feel stiff, but breaking them in properly will enhance comfort and performance. Wear them during light bag work to help them conform to your hands. Avoid over-tightening the wrist straps at first, allowing the gloves to gradually mold to your hand shape while maintaining flexibility.
